Federal

Fed Phd1952 Ultra- Shok Hd 12ga 3.5 " 1- 5/8oz # 2 10/5

$29.99 $44.99

In-Stock
brand Federal
SKU PHD1952
UPC 029465025380
Warehouse Stock 0
Store Stock 2
No Description Available.
Overall Rating
0.0/5.0
Review Stats 0 total reviews

No reviews have been written for this product.